Jouer Skinny Dip Palette

I first saw this palette when Jouer released their Skinny Dip make-up collection and I nearly bought it, but I changed my mind because I already have a million palettes. As you can see, I have changed my mind again and I am very glad that I did.
The packaging is quite compact. It is made out of reflective foil gold cardboard and the typography is simple. It has a magnetic closing, which you lift to reveal a small rectangular mirror on one side and then the six eyeshadow pans on the other. The shade names are written underneath each pan.

You get six ultra-foil shimmer eyeshadows in blinding shades with a net weight of 7.5g. The sixth shade is actually described as more of a glitter shade.
STAR LIGHT - platinum
BIKINI - champagne pink
SKINNY DIP - champagne gold
TAN LINES - antique bronze
MAGIC HOUR - warm taupe
MIDNIGHT SWIM - cocoa bronze

The eyeshadows should be highly pigmented, have an intense shimmery and metallic finish, be long wearing and crease-resistant. They should also layer together perfectly or look great for just an accent colour. The palette is also paraben free, sulphate free, phthalate free and dermatologist tested.

These eyeshadows are amazing! They are extremely pigmented and foiled. They are also really soft, buttery and the consistency is not thin so they last for ages on your eyes. I always recommend using eye primer and I would recommend that you do your base make-up after applying these as there are a lot of fall out glitters with these shades. You can apply them wet, you don’t need to but it might help with the fall out. I find that using a stiff synthetic brush applies them better. I tried using a regular eyeshadow brush and the bristles were just too soft to pick up the pigment. I used the Sigma Short Shader - E20 brush to apply the Star Light shade to my inner corners and it looked absolutely and incredibly stunning! Star Light is definitely my favourite shade! I can’t stress enough how much I love and recommend this palette. I wouldn’t say it is for everyday casual use, but it sure is a treat to wear for special occasions.
